LinkedIn respects your privacy

LinkedIn and 3rd parties use essential and non-essential cookies to provide, secure, analyze and improve our Services, and to show you relevant ads (including professional and job ads) on and off LinkedIn. Learn more in our Cookie Policy.

Select Accept to consent or Reject to decline non-essential cookies for this use. You can update your choices at any time in your settings.

Agree & Join LinkedIn

By clicking Continue to join or sign in, you agree to LinkedIn’s User Agreement, Privacy Policy, and Cookie Policy.

Skip to main content
LinkedIn
  • Top Content
  • People
  • Learning
  • Jobs
  • Games
Join now Sign in
Last updated on Feb 19, 2025
  1. All
  2. IT Services
  3. Information Technology

Struggling to minimize disruptions during system upgrades?

Smooth system upgrades require foresight and structure. To minimize downtime:

- Schedule upgrades during off-peak hours to reduce the impact on operations.

- Communicate changes to all stakeholders well in advance.

- Test updates in a controlled environment before full deployment.

How do you tackle the challenges of system upgrades? Share your strategies.

Information Technology Information Technology

Information Technology

+ Follow
Last updated on Feb 19, 2025
  1. All
  2. IT Services
  3. Information Technology

Struggling to minimize disruptions during system upgrades?

Smooth system upgrades require foresight and structure. To minimize downtime:

- Schedule upgrades during off-peak hours to reduce the impact on operations.

- Communicate changes to all stakeholders well in advance.

- Test updates in a controlled environment before full deployment.

How do you tackle the challenges of system upgrades? Share your strategies.

Add your perspective
Help others by sharing more (125 characters min.)
81 answers
  • Contributor profile photo
    Contributor profile photo
    Santosh Kumar

    CISSP, PMP, CISA, CHFI, CIPP/E, CIPM, AIGP | Cybersecurity & Data Protection Leader | GenAI Architect | Fellow of Information Privacy (FIP) | Navy Veteran 🏫 IIT Madras| IIM Indore

    • Report contribution

    "The pain of transition creates the gain of transformation." 🎯 Schedule midnight-to-4am upgrade windows when user activity drops below 5%. 🎯 Create parallel systems - run old and new simultaneously during transition. 🎯 Implement rolling upgrades across server clusters to maintain partial availability. 🎯 Use containerization to isolate dependencies and enable instant rollbacks. 🎯 Develop predictive analytics to identify optimal upgrade timing based on usage patterns. 🎯 Gamify the experience - turn planned downtime into "treasure hunts" with rewards. 🎯 Establish "upgrade champions" across departments to test and advocate for changes. 🎯 Split upgrades into micro-deployments spread across days rather than one massive change.

    Like
    8
  • Contributor profile photo
    Contributor profile photo
    Luis Valente ™

    Information Security & Cyber-Intelligence | Privacy • Compliance • Risk Management | Protect Your Clients' Data & Preserve Your Reputation

    • Report contribution

    Minimizing disruptions during upgrades is a common challenge, but there are effective strategies to tackle it: 1. Plan meticulously: Create a detailed roadmap and timeline 2. Communicate clearly: Keep all stakeholders informed throughout the process 3. Test rigorously: Conduct thorough testing in a staging environment 4. Schedule smartly: Choose low-impact times for upgrades 5. Have a rollback plan: Be prepared to revert if issues arise In my experience, involving end-users in the testing phase can uncover potential problems early on... a smooth upgrade isn't just about technology, it's about people and processes too.

    Like
    7
  • Contributor profile photo
    Contributor profile photo
    Ankit Singh

    Purchase Executive @Shriram Enterprises(HO)| MBA🧑💻 Procurement Expert ► Specialist in risk management and cost reduction • Purchase Order Management, Supplier Relations, Inventory Control.

    • Report contribution

    To minimize disruptions during system upgrades, plan ahead, conduct thorough testing, implement a phased rollout, provide clear communication, and have a robust rollback plan.

    Like
    5
  • Contributor profile photo
    Contributor profile photo
    Sanjeev Kumar Mishra, PMP®

    Digital Transformation | Product Strategy | Compliance | Social Impact | Continuous Learner | PMP®

    • Report contribution

    Minimize system upgrade disruptions with these key strategies: 1. Plan & Assess Risks – Identify critical processes, conduct risk analysis, and prepare contingency plans. 2. Strategic Scheduling – Perform upgrades during off-peak hours with advance stakeholder communication. 3. Phased Rollout – Test in a staging environment, deploy in phases, and monitor for issues. 4. Backup & Rollback Plan – Ensure full system backups and a rollback strategy. 5. Clear Communication – Inform users about downtime, changes, and support options. 6. Automation – Utilize CI/CD pipelines and automated testing for efficiency. 7. Post-Upgrade Monitoring – Assign a support team and use real-time monitoring to address issues swiftly.

    Like
    4
  • Contributor profile photo
    Contributor profile photo
    Basima Ja'ara

    Ph.D. in Management | PMP/PMI, ISTQB, ITIL, WCM Portal, EOT | Creativity & Innovation

    • Report contribution

    1. Plan upgrades during low-traffic periods to reduce disruption risks. 2. Communicate with users beforehand to prepare for potential downtime. 3. Test upgrades in staging environments to identify and resolve issues. 4. Monitor system performance closely post-upgrade for quick problem detection.

    Like
    4
  • Contributor profile photo
    Contributor profile photo
    Sharad Sanodiya

    AVP - Application Support ,SRE and DevOps Senior Engineer

    • Report contribution

    Minimizing disruptions during system upgrades is as essentials as keeping system up to date. - Embedded culture of considering upgrades as planned work to follow complete SDLC cycle. - Document each upgrade learnings along with automating any manual work. - Advance agreement on downtime with all stakeholders wrt to non-prod env. - Rollback plan agreed and documented, mostly has to be automated. - SLI and track it according to SLO available error budget.

    Like
    3
  • Contributor profile photo
    Contributor profile photo
    Amin Amini

    DevOps enthusiast | AWS | k8s | Docker | Terraform | Ansible | Git | CI/CD | Python | Node.js | Monitoring | Zabbix | Grafana | T-SQL | Linux | Payment Specialist (PCI DSS and etc)

    • Report contribution

    To minimize disruptions during system upgrades, I schedule them during off-peak hours to reduce operational impact and ensure smoother transitions. I communicate changes clearly to all stakeholders well in advance, providing timelines and potential effects to set expectations. Before full deployment, I rigorously test updates in a controlled environment to identify and resolve issues early. For example, in a recent upgrade, I used a phased rollout, starting with a small user group to validate stability before expanding. This approach, combined with detailed rollback plans, ensures minimal downtime and a seamless upgrade process.

    Like
    3
  • Contributor profile photo
    Contributor profile photo
    Mostafa El-kady

    CIO ,Technology strategist | MBA, TOGAF, ITIL, AWS architect Certified, certified business planning professional

    • Report contribution

    A strong change management process is the key, ensure proper communication, plan the change well , have a solid communication plan ,meanwhile choose the architecture pattern that satisfy the target RPO and RTO

    Like
    3
  • Contributor profile photo
    Contributor profile photo
    Muhammad Akif

    Building AI-driven MVPs for tech startups in just 60 days | Founder/CEO at Techling LLC

    • Report contribution

    I always start by picking a quiet time for the upgrade, usually when the team’s not active. Then I send a clear update to everyone so they know what to expect. We test everything in a small group first to catch issues early. These simple steps help us avoid chaos and keep things running smooth.

    Like
    3
  • Contributor profile photo
    Contributor profile photo
    Roopesh Kesava Reddy

    Actively Looking for New Positions| Cloud-Native & Event-Driven Architectures | ETL Pipelines | GCP| BigQuery | Dataflow | Informatica | Kafka | SQL | Python | Data Modeling | CI/CD | Agile | Data Quality & Governance

    • Report contribution

    To minimize disruptions during system upgrades, schedule updates during off-peak hours and notify users in advance. Use a staging environment to test changes before deployment. Implement rollback plans to quickly restore functionality if issues arise. Monitor system performance post-upgrade to address any unexpected problems promptly.

    Like
    2
View more answers
Information Technology Information Technology

Information Technology

+ Follow

Rate this article

We created this article with the help of AI. What do you think of it?
It’s great It’s not so great

Thanks for your feedback

Your feedback is private. Like or react to bring the conversation to your network.

Tell us more

Report this article

More articles on Information Technology

No more previous content
  • You're facing resistance to IT infrastructure changes. How will you overcome the obstacles?

    52 contributions

  • Your team is divided on disaster recovery testing methods. How will you find the best approach?

    27 contributions

  • You're torn between conflicting views on IT automation. How do you navigate the debate effectively?

    76 contributions

  • You're navigating IT project discussions with non-technical stakeholders. How do you earn their trust?

    37 contributions

  • You're leading an IT-driven initiative with non-technical teams. How do you gain their buy-in?

    80 contributions

  • You're moving from legacy systems to new solutions. How do you ensure data integrity?

    84 contributions

  • You're facing complex technical issues. How do you foster effective teamwork in solving them swiftly?

  • Your IT vendors' performance is crucial to your success. How do you regularly evaluate them?

  • A team member feels their IT contributions are overlooked. How do you address their concerns?

  • Your virtual IT team's performance is lagging due to communication breakdowns. How will you address this?

No more next content
See all

More relevant reading

  • IT Services
    How do you calculate the mean time between failures (MTBF) in incident response?
  • IT Operations
    How do IT Operations professionals identify problems that need to be solved?
  • Systems Engineering
    What are the best ways to ensure system reliability and resilience in the face of change?
  • Problem Solving
    Your supplier misses the mark on delivery. How will you salvage the situation?

Explore Other Skills

  • IT Strategy
  • System Administration
  • Technical Support
  • Cybersecurity
  • IT Management
  • Software Project Management
  • IT Consulting
  • IT Operations
  • Data Management
  • Information Security

Are you sure you want to delete your contribution?

Are you sure you want to delete your reply?

  • LinkedIn © 2025
  • About
  • Accessibility
  • User Agreement
  • Privacy Policy
  • Cookie Policy
  • Copyright Policy
  • Brand Policy
  • Guest Controls
  • Community Guidelines
Like
11
81 Contributions